Description:
Bilingual (French-Greek) edition. Soft cover, 20 cm, 304 pp. ISBN: 978-960-9538-29-9."There is no civilization without memory, there is no society without ruins", recalls Alain Schnapp. From ancient Egypt to China, through the peoples of Mesopotamia and the Greco-Roman world, the author explores the variety of uses of material remains of antiquity and compares their share in the development of memory strategies.
